Overview

If you are asking, why are my lights flickering, the first step is to narrow the pattern. A single lamp flickering points you in a different direction than lights flickering in house across several rooms. That distinction matters because lighting problems often start in one of three places: the fixture itself, the branch circuit serving that room, or the home’s broader electrical system.

In practical terms, flicker usually falls into these categories:

  • One bulb or one fixture: often a bulb compatibility issue, a loose lamp, a worn socket, or a failing switch.
  • One room or part of one floor: often a circuit-level problem such as a loose connection, overloaded circuit, damaged receptacle, or breaker issue.
  • Multiple rooms when large appliances start: often voltage drop, an undersized or heavily shared circuit, or panel and service capacity concerns.
  • Whole-house flicker: more concerning, especially if lights dim or brighten unpredictably. This can point to a service connection problem, neutral issue, panel defect, or utility-side trouble.

Some flicker is minor and localized. Some is an early warning that warrants fast home electrical repair. The goal is not to diagnose every internal defect yourself. It is to identify what is safe to observe, what patterns to document, and what signs mean you should stop troubleshooting and call for residential electrical services.

Before doing anything, treat these as urgent red flags:

  • Burning smell near a switch, outlet, fixture, or panel
  • Buzzing or crackling sounds from walls, devices, or breakers
  • Sparks, scorch marks, or melted plastic
  • Lights that get suddenly brighter as well as dimmer
  • Flicker paired with warm outlets or switches
  • Breaker keeps tripping after reset
  • Recent storm damage, water intrusion, or rodent activity around wiring

Maintenance cycle

The most useful way to handle flickering light troubleshooting is not to wait until the problem becomes obvious. Lighting issues often develop gradually. A simple maintenance cycle helps you catch changes early and gives an electrician better information if service is needed.

Monthly or seasonally, do a quick lighting check:

  • Walk through the house at night and turn on commonly used fixtures.
  • Notice whether any room flickers when HVAC equipment, a microwave, vacuum, hair dryer, or refrigerator starts.
  • Check dimmers, smart switches, and LED fixtures for inconsistent behavior.
  • Look for patterns tied to weather, time of day, or heavy appliance use.

Why revisit after upgrades? Because flicker can appear when a new load is added to an already busy circuit, when an older dimmer is paired with LED lamps, or when hidden weaknesses in the panel start showing up under changing demand. Homes that are adding more electrified loads often benefit from a broader review of panel capacity and circuit layout. Keep a simple log. Note:

  • Which room or fixtures flicker
  • Whether the flicker is random, constant, or tied to switching on another device
  • Whether lights dim only or also brighten
  • Whether only LEDs flicker or incandescent lamps do too
  • Any recent electrical installation services or remodeling work

This kind of record often shortens diagnosis time and helps separate fixture problems from circuit and service issues.

Signals that require updates

Lighting systems evolve. So does the way homeowners use power. This topic should be revisited on a scheduled review cycle because the most common causes of flicker can shift as equipment changes. A house that once had only simple switches and incandescent bulbs may now include recessed LED drivers, dimmers, smart home controls, surge devices, standby power equipment, and high-demand charging loads.

Update your understanding of the issue when any of these signals appear:

1. The type of lighting changed

LEDs are efficient, but they can reveal problems older bulbs hid. Incompatible dimmers, poor-quality drivers, loose neutral connections, or fluctuating voltage may show up as visible shimmer or intermittent flicker. If the issue started after a bulb swap or light fixture installation, compatibility is worth checking first. Confirm that the lamp is rated for the fixture and, if a dimmer is involved, that the bulbs and control are designed to work together.

2. Smart devices were added

Smart switches, occupancy sensors, and app-controlled dimmers do not behave exactly like standard switches. Some need a neutral conductor. Some have minimum load requirements. Some interact poorly with certain LED fixtures. If flicker started after a smart home installation service or DIY device swap, the problem may be setup-related rather than a hidden wiring defect.

3. New heavy loads were installed

An EV charger, electric range, heat pump, workshop tool, or space heater can reveal voltage drop and capacity issues that previously went unnoticed. If lights flicker when a new large load starts, that pattern deserves attention. It may call for dedicated circuit installation, load balancing, panel review, or service upgrade planning.

4. The symptoms spread

A flickering dining room pendant is one thing. Flicker moving from one room to several rooms is different. Spread suggests the problem may be upstream of the original fixture, such as a shared circuit splice, a breaker connection, a neutral issue, or a panel defect.

5. The home has older wiring or deferred repairs

If you live in an older home, especially one with a history of piecemeal electrical changes, flicker deserves a more cautious read. Aging switches, worn receptacles, backstabbed connections, damaged insulation, aluminum branch wiring in some homes, and undocumented additions can all contribute to intermittent lighting problems. In these cases, an inspection is often more useful than repeated guesswork.

Common issues

Here are the most common flickering lights causes, starting with the simplest and moving toward issues that generally belong to professional repair.

Loose bulb or failing lamp

This is the easiest possibility to rule out. Turn off power at the switch, let the lamp cool, and make sure the bulb is seated correctly. If the bulb is old or suspect, replace it with a known-good bulb of the correct type and rating. If the flicker disappears, the problem may have been the lamp itself.

Clue: one fixture, one bulb, no other electrical symptoms.

Incompatible LED bulb and dimmer

This is extremely common in homes that upgraded to LEDs without changing older controls. Some dimmers were designed around incandescent loads and do not regulate low-wattage LED lamps smoothly. You may notice shimmer at low dim levels, delayed turn-on, or random flicker.

What you can check: whether the bulbs are dimmable, whether the dimmer is LED-compatible, and whether the issue occurs only on dimmed settings.

Worn switch or bad socket contact

A switch can wear internally over time. Lamp sockets can also lose tension or develop carbon buildup. A fixture may flicker when you touch the switch, bump the lamp, or move the fixture slightly.

Red flag: if a switch feels hot, crackles, or shows discoloration, stop using it until it is inspected.

Loose connection in a fixture box, switch box, or receptacle

This is where the issue becomes more serious. Loose connections create resistance and heat. They may work intermittently, especially as loads change. The flicker may seem random at first, then become more frequent.

Typical pattern: one room, one switch leg, or a group of outlets and lights on the same circuit showing erratic behavior.

This type of fault is a common reason to call a pro for flickering lights repair. Troubleshooting inside boxes involves energized conductors, code considerations, and safe terminations.

Overloaded or poorly distributed circuit

If lights dip when a hair dryer, portable heater, microwave, vacuum, or window AC starts, the circuit may be carrying more than it should comfortably handle, or the load may simply be causing noticeable voltage drop on that branch. In some homes, too many outlets, lights, and appliances share one circuit due to past remodeling or limited original design.

What to look for: flicker that appears only when another device starts or cycles.

An electrician may recommend separating loads, adding a dedicated circuit, or reviewing whether an electrical panel upgrade makes sense.

Failing breaker or weak panel connection

Breakers do more than trip. They also form mechanical and electrical connections within the panel. A failing breaker or poor connection at the breaker can create intermittent problems that show up as flicker, nuisance trips, or heat. This is not a DIY inspection area for most homeowners.

Loose or failing neutral connection

This is one of the more important electrical warning signs. A neutral issue can cause lights to dim in one area and brighten in another, especially on multi-wire or shared conditions, and can affect multiple circuits at once. Homeowners may describe this as lights acting “wild,” “pulsing,” or changing intensity when large loads come on.

Take this seriously: unusual brightening is often more concerning than simple dimming.

A neutral problem can be in a branch circuit, panel, meter area, or utility connection. Professional diagnosis is the right path.

Utility-side or service entrance issue

If the whole house flickers, especially during wind, rain, or neighborhood load changes, the issue may be outside the branch circuits entirely. Service conductors, meter components, weather exposure, and utility connections can all play a role. If neighbors report similar issues, that supports a utility-side possibility, though it does not rule out a problem inside your home.

Surge, storm, or backup power transition problems

Flicker after a storm or after changes to backup power equipment can point to damaged components or transfer behavior that needs review. If you have generator or battery-related equipment, look at symptoms in context. What you can safely do before calling

  • Replace one suspect bulb with a known-good matching bulb.
  • Test whether the issue happens only with a dimmer or smart control active.
  • Unplug portable high-draw devices on the same circuit and observe whether symptoms change.
  • Check whether the problem is isolated to one fixture, one room, or the whole home.
  • Document timing, weather, and appliance interactions.

What not to do: do not open the panel cover, reterminate wires in live boxes, bypass a breaker, or continue using devices that smell hot or show arcing signs.

The simplest rule is this: a flicker with a clear, harmless cause can be corrected and monitored. A flicker with no obvious cause, a growing pattern, or any sign of heat, noise, brightening, or breaker involvement deserves professional attention.
